Output 888688e6fc50899d23ce88cc25128c0bbc1afd4265519b029767c5568e53262c:1

value
29557293
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 255d9978da76d3dd446d8b011b40aa34ca742fa7 OP_EQUALVERIFY OP_CHECKSIG
address
14Qa8WHtaLmq38h75cRPx3bBqREXp2snNY
transaction
888688e6fc50899d23ce88cc25128c0bbc1afd4265519b029767c5568e53262c
spent
true